Is mesh a logical topology?

This full connectivity is a property of the network protocols, not the topology; any network can appear fully meshed at the logical level if data can be routed between each of its users. Mesh networks are where the difference between logical and physical topologies are most important.

How does a mesh network work?

In a wireless mesh network, each node receives data from one node while forwarding data to the next node. The resulting network between connected devices is often called a mesh cloud. Having more nodes increases the range of the network that the mesh client devices can connect to for internet.

What are the basic principles of a mesh network?

Basic principles. Mesh networks can relay messages using either a flooding technique or a routing technique. With routing, the message is propagated along a path by hopping from node to node until it reaches its destination.

What are the advantages of mesh networking?

Mesh networking. Mesh networks dynamically self-organize and self-configure, which can reduce installation overhead. The ability to self-configure enables dynamic distribution of workloads, particularly in the event that a few nodes should fail. This in turn contributes to fault-tolerance and reduced maintenance costs.

What are the characteristics of a mesh topology?

Characteristics of a mesh topology are as follows: A mesh topology provides redundant links across the network. If a break occurs in a segment of cable, traffic can still be rerouted using the other cables.

What is a fully connected mesh network?

Mesh networking. Illustration of a partially connected mesh network. A fully connected mesh network is where each node is connected to every other node in the network.
